dixie aneas J TECH TIPS Dixie Part Numbers: TBA Applications: 2008 — 2010 Kawasaki Ninja ZX-10R 2009 — 2012 Kawasaki Ninja ZX-6R Conditions: The operator of the vehicle may complain of one or more of the following conditions: – A failure to crank or start. – The engine stalls and cannot be restarted. When testing the electrical system the technician may observe lower then the normal voltage of 14V. Cause: A potential cause for the above conditions is a manufacturing flaw in the voltage regulator/rectifier assembly resulting in the voltage setting to be too low. Correction: Follow the manufacturer’s recommended diagnostic and repair procedures when applicable.
